COMPASS is a prospective multicenter randomized interventional trial. Participants with ductal-dependent pulmonary blood flow will be randomized to receive either a systemic-to-pulmonary artery shunt or ductal artery stent. Block randomization will be performed by center and by single vs. two ventricle status. Participants will be followed through the first year of life.

In neonates with ductal-dependent blood flow there remains valid uncertainty regarding the comparative benefits of ductal artery stent (DAS) with the traditional systemic-to-pulmonary artery shunt (SPS) palliation due to the lack of previous multicenter studies. COMPASS is a prospective multicenter randomized interventional trial where participants will be randomized to receive either an SPS or DAS to compare rates of a composite major morbidity/mortality endpoint in the first year of life. The study objectives are to perform an intention-to-treat analysis of participants' outcomes, and to describe the failure rate for neonatal candidates for DAS and the impact of this failure on the post-SPS course. Participants will be followed through the first year of life.

A surgical connection will be made between a systemic artery and the pulmonary artery.
Time frame: 1 year
Rates of a composite major morbidity and/or mortality endpoint in the first year of life will be compared between neonates with ductal-dependent pulmonary blood flow randomized to receive either DAS or SPS as the initial palliation.
Time frame: 1 year
All participants will be assigned a Global Rank Score, which is a rank based on a pre-specified hierarchical ranking of outcomes. This combines various endpoints into a single quantifiable endpoint with weighting of the severity of the component endpoints, and allows for the inclusion of endpoints of different forms. Global rank scores will range from 1-7.
Time frame: 1 year
Safety, defined as freedom from procedural adverse events and complications, will be tracked and evaluated.
Time frame: 1 year
Days alive out of the hospital represents a patient-centered outcome, and functions as a composite endpoint.
